1. Recording Tools — Capture Studio-Quality Audio & Video

A great podcast starts with great audio quality. As an educator, you may record solo episodes or interview guests remotely. The right recording tool ensures clean, separate tracks that are easy to edit afterward.

Riverside.fm — Best Remote Recording for Educators

🎙️ Riverside.fm

20% Recurring Commission

From $15/month (Standard) · Free tier available

Riverside.fm is the gold standard for remote podcast recording. It records each participant locally on their device, uploading high-quality 4K video and 48kHz WAV audio tracks in real-time. This means even with a slow internet connection, you get studio-quality recordings. For educators interviewing students, fellow experts, or coaching clients, Riverside's separate track recording makes post-production editing effortless.

Key features include: automatic cloud backup, live call-in feature for audience participation, separate audio/video tracks per participant, AI-powered text-based editing, and automatic transcript generation. Riverside also produces highlight clips automatically using AI, saving hours of manual clipping for social media.

Podcastle — All-in-One Recording Suite

🎧 Podcastle

20% Recurring Commission

From $11.99/month (Storyteller) · Free tier available

Podcastle combines recording, editing, and basic hosting into one intuitive platform. Its "Magic Dust" feature removes background noise with one click, and the AI voice editor lets you edit audio by removing, duplicating, or rearranging words as if editing a document. Podcastle also offers a multi-track recording studio for up to 10 participants, making it ideal for group coaching calls or panel discussions.

For educators who want simplicity, Podcastle's all-in-one approach minimizes the number of tools you need to learn. The free tier includes recording up to 1 hour per project with basic editing — enough to get started.

2. Editing Tools — AI-Powered Post-Production

Editing is often the most time-consuming part of podcasting. AI-powered editing tools have transformed the workflow, cutting editing time by up to 80%. For busy educators, this is a game-changer.

Descript — The AI Editor That Changed Podcasting

✂️ Descript

20% Recurring Commission

From $24/month (Hobbyist) · Free plan available

Descript has revolutionized podcast editing by treating audio like a text document. You can delete words from the transcript and they disappear from the audio. Add new words with Descript's AI voice generator, and it sounds natural. Remove filler words like "um," "uh," and "like" with a single click.

For educators, Descript's screen recording capability means you can create video tutorials that automatically generate transcripts and chapters. The AI-powered "Studio Sound" enhances audio quality to broadcast standards. Descript also generates show notes, social media clips, and subtitles automatically — making content repurposing seamless.

💡 Educator Pro Tip: Repurpose Everything

Use Descript's AI tools to turn one podcast episode into: a blog post (export transcript → AI rewrite), 3-5 social media clips (auto-highlight reel), a YouTube video (add captions + chapters), an email newsletter (use the AI summary), and course materials (extract key segments). This single-episode repurposing strategy can save 10+ hours per week.

Headliner — Audiogram & Social Media Clips

Headliner lets you create audiograms — shareable video clips with waveform animations and captions. These perform significantly better than static images on social media. The pro version includes auto-captioning, voice-to-text, and podcast teaser creation. Headliner's affiliate program pays 30% recurring commission on paid plans.

Repurpose.io — Cross-Platform Distribution

Repurpose.io automatically distributes your podcast episodes to YouTube, TikTok, LinkedIn, Twitter, and Facebook. For educators managing multiple channels, this tool eliminates hours of manual uploading. Set it once, and every new episode gets distributed to every platform automatically.

Do I need video podcasting as an educator or coach?

Yes. Video podcasting has become essential in 2026. Platforms like YouTube and Spotify now prioritize video podcasts, and educators can repurpose video content for course materials, social media clips, and YouTube Shorts. Tools like Riverside.fm and Descript make video podcasting seamless.

Can I edit my podcast with free tools as an educator?

Yes. Audacity and DaVinci Resolve are free and capable tools. However, Descript's AI-powered editor can save educators 5-10 hours per episode by removing filler words and generating transcripts automatically, making it well worth the subscription for busy course creators.

How often should educators publish podcast episodes?

Weekly is the sweet spot for building an audience. Consistency matters more than frequency. Many successful education podcasts publish one 20-40 minute episode per week, often repurposing existing webinar or course content to minimize production time.

Can I host private podcast episodes for my course members?

Yes. Captivate.fm offers private podcasting features that let you deliver exclusive episodes to paying students. This is a powerful way to add value to your course or membership program. Other hosts like Transistor also support private feeds.

What equipment do I need to start a podcast as an educator?

Start with a USB microphone (like Blue Yeti or Rode NT-USB), a quiet room, and free recording software. As you grow, invest in an XLR mic setup (Shure SM7B or Rode PodMic), audio interface, and acoustic treatment. Good content matters more than expensive gear — educators often excel because they already have valuable knowledge to share.
